 Mikel Arteta couldn't conceal his disappointment on the touchline as Kieran Tierney, who had a challenging afternoon, misplaced a straightforward pass during Arsenal's Community Shield triumph over Manchester City. Journalist Ryan Taylor observed the moment when Arteta expressed frustration with the left-back, who has been facing tough competition for his position, notably from Jurrien Timber, who performed well against City.



Tierney's introduction coincided with City's goal, scored by Cole Palmer from Arsenal's left flank, further adding to the manager's vexation. Arteta seems to prefer a right-footed player in the left-back role, someone capable of moving into midfield, which doesn't naturally suit Tierney's style as he excels in getting down the line and delivering crosses.


As the summer transfer window nears its end, Tierney's situation is worth monitoring, considering his potential struggles for game-time if Arteta continues to favor Timber on the left. This could lead to reservations about his future at Arsenal. Unfortunately, in the recent match, Tierney failed to make the most of his opportunity.
